Space has become critical infrastructure for both security and sustainability. Satellites provide the data and connectivity needed to monitor climate change, track emissions and natural disasters, protect oceans and critical infrastructure, and support emergency preparedness. At the same time, space-based services are increasingly essential for national security, navigation, communication and situational awareness in an uncertain geopolitical landscape. As society becomes more dependent on digital systems and global connectivity, space technology is no longer distant future technology — it is a fundamental part of everyday life and resilience.

KSAT (Kongsberg Satellite Services) is a world-leading provider of satellite communication and Earth observation services, operating one of the world’s most advanced global ground station networks. From strategically placed stations in the Arctic, Antarctica and across the globe, KSAT enables real-time communication with satellites, supporting everything from climate monitoring and maritime surveillance to defense, emergency response and secure communications.

With hundreds of antennas across more than 40 locations, KSAT delivers critical services for spacecraft operations, launch support and data downlinking, making space infrastructure accessible “as a service” for governments, commercial operators and international space agencies.

As part of the Norwegian KONGSBERG ecosystem and co-owned by Space Norway, KSAT plays a vital role in strengthening Europe’s technological sovereignty and demonstrating how space has become essential infrastructure for modern society — enabling navigation, weather forecasting, environmental monitoring, security, connectivity and informed decision-making on Earth.
